Amid rise in sales at government-controlled ration shops, masur prices declined by ₹150 per quintal, with the price of masur (bold) in Indore mandis today down to ₹3,850 a quintal, while masur (medium) ruled at ₹3,600. Masur dal (medium) quoted at ₹4,800-4,900, while masur dal (bold) ruled at ₹5,000-5,100 a quintal.
